AI Summary

  • Creates Section 41-57-33 of Mississippi Code to allow the State Registrar to issue a Certificate of Foreign Birth without judicial proceedings for children adopted from foreign countries who hold a Certificate of Citizenship under the federal Child Citizenship Act.

  • Exempts eligible children from existing judicial proceeding requirements in Sections 93-17-301 through 93-17-307 for obtaining birth certificates following foreign adoptions.

  • Requires submission of six documents to the State Registrar: Certificate of Citizenship, certified foreign birth certificate with English translation, certified adoption documents from the U.S. Embassy with English translation, child's Social Security card, valid government-issued photo identification of parent(s), and proof of Mississippi residency.

  • Directs the State Registrar to develop necessary forms for adoptive parents to request a Certificate of Foreign Birth.

  • Takes effect July 1, 2021.

Legislative Description

Certificate of Foreign Birth; authorize without judicial proceeding under certain circumstances.
